1

Why choosing professional shingle roof replacement Riverside offers long-term performance

News Discuss 
Checking Out Comprehensive Roof Providers: Installment, Repair Works, and Upkeep for Your Homes Defense Roof services play an important function in protecting a home. They incorporate setup, repairs, and upkeep, each necessary for durability and performance. Property owners typically forget the nuances of their roof needs. Understanding different products and https://rafaelcrtri.tokka-blog.com/38686820/how-roof-installation-temecula-experts-provide-quality-craftsmanship-and-precision

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story